Output e80c7205292646a177cb3e00369e55cd28af911157616f15ba9a8968508e5c23:1

value
15840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95745f921e3fba5427982f35dc9dae6573ee37e6 OP_EQUALVERIFY OP_CHECKSIG
address
1EdF6LtpdH11QGFsR1ki8xLRwHiNP3MPyo
transaction
e80c7205292646a177cb3e00369e55cd28af911157616f15ba9a8968508e5c23
confirmations
517950
spent
true